BTS Star J-Hope Buys Two Luxurious Apartments In Seoul

BTS star J-Hope has recently made headlines by significantly expanding his real estate investments. According to various South Korean media outlets, he has purchased two luxury apartments in Seoul, reflecting his growing portfolio.

The first acquisition is a penthouse located in the prestigious Afer Hangang apartment complex. Which he acquired for a notable 12 billion KRW (approximately Rs. 75 crore) in cash. Shortly after, he bought an additional unit directly below the penthouse for about 10 billion KRW (approximately Rs. 62 crore). Combined, these transactions are valued at approximately Rs. 1,377 crore, marking a substantial investment in high-end real estate.

Details of J-Hope’s New Properties

J-Hope finalized the ownership transfer for these properties in June of this year, opting to make these purchases without taking on any loans. The penthouse spans 273.86 square meters and features three rooms and four bathrooms, offering ample space and luxury. The apartment directly below it covers 232.86 square meters and includes three bedrooms and three bathrooms, all situated on a single floor. These latest additions enhance J-Hope’s impressive real estate portfolio, which now includes four high-end properties—two in the Afer Hangang complex and two in the Trimage development.
